The Social and Economic Benefits of Arts Villages
Beyond fostering cultural exchange, arts villages contribute significantly to the social and economic well-being of their communities. By attracting tourists and art enthusiasts, these spaces generate economic activity that benefits local businesses and artisans. Furthermore, cultural arts activities in arts villages often lead to increased community pride and social cohesion. The sense of belonging and identity that emerges from participating in these activities strengthens communal bonds and fosters a supportive environment for cultural preservation.
Case Study: Arts Villages in Fiji
Fiji represents a fascinating case study in how arts villages can serve as conduits for cultural exchange and collaboration. Known for their rich traditions and vibrant cultural arts activities, Fijian arts villages are a vital part of the country’s cultural landscape. They offer visitors and locals alike the opportunity to engage with indigenous art forms, such as traditional dance, music, and crafts.
